RELATED ORGANIZATIONS

Integrity (www.integrityusa.org): Integrity is a nonprofit organization of GLBT Episcopalians founded in 1974 and has been a leading voice for full inclusion of GLBT Episcopalians in the church. This organization concerns itself with advocacy and political action. Integrity maintains both local chapters and diocesan networks in this country. Both the Newark and California Oasis groups are members of Integrity.

Claiming the Blessing (www.claimingtheblessing.org): CLAIMING the BLESSING is an intentional collaborative ministry of leading Episcopal justice organizations including Integrity, all three Oasis groups, Beyond Inclusion and the Episcopal Women's Caucus. Claiming the Blessing is focused on promoting wholeness in human relationships, abolishing prejudice and oppression, and healing the rift between sexuality and spirituality in the Church.

Episcopal Women’s Caucus (www.ewc-ecusa.org): This group is concerned mainly with the full inclusion of women in the church but also supports GLBT causes.

Beyond Inclusion (www.beyondinclusion.org): Beyond Inclusion plays a cooperative role in the work of convincing the Episcopal Church to develop rites for the blessing of couples living in life-long committed relationships other than marriage.

Other Oasis Groups The Newark Oasis (Diocese of Newark, NJ) is the oldest of the Oasis organizations but there are also Oasis groups in California (www.oasiscalifornia.org), Michigan (oasismichigan.org), and Missouri (www.missouri.anglican.org/GLM.htm).
